#358505 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#358505 is composed of 20.8% red, 52.2% green and 2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 60.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 96.2% yellow and 47.8% black. It has a hue angle of 97.5 degrees, a saturation of 92.8% and a lightness of 27.1%. #358505 color hex could be obtained by blending #6aff0a with #000b00. Closest websafe color is: #339900.

Shades and Tints of #358505
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000100 is the darkest color, while #f3feed is the lightest one.

Tones of #358505
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#454545 is the less saturated color, while #358505 is the most saturated one.
